Preschool
Our Program
St. Vincent de Paul Preschool offers a play-based, hands-on program because we believe young children learn best through interaction, exploration, and experimentation. Low student-to-teacher ratios allow our teachers to individualize learning to meet children where they are developmentally. Encompassing all the learning at our preschool is our Catholic faith which is integrated into every aspect of our day to help children grow in their love and knowledge of God.
